Reach for Rock Climb Rumble when your child is facing a new, high-pressure challenge that makes them want to retreat. This book is a perfect tool for children who struggle with 'performance paralysis' or those who find it difficult to trust others in a team setting. It follows characters who must navigate the literal and figurative ups and downs of a rock climbing competition, emphasizing that bravery is not the absence of fear, but the willingness to keep going with a little help. Through the accessible medium of a graphic novel, the story explores deep themes of anxiety, trust, and resilience. It is highly appropriate for the 8 to 12 age range, offering a realistic look at how nerves can affect physical performance. Parents will appreciate how it models healthy communication and the importance of relying on a partner, making it an excellent choice for kids starting new sports or dealing with school-related stress.
